"Gross domestic product (GDP) was never designed to be a measure of societal well-being. It tracks only market transactions, conflates costs and benefits, and ignores the distribution of income, household labor, and social and environmental costs and benefits."

www.nature.com/articles/d41...
Beyond growth — why we need to agree on an alternative to GDP now
The world needs to move towards an approach to measure well-being rather than economic growth. Here’s how that can happen.
